A Closer Look at the Itinerary

Auckland City Of Sails Half Day Private Tour - A Closer Look at the Itinerary

Bastion Point: A Scenic Prologue

The tour kicks off at Bastion Point, a place renowned for its spectacular views of Auckland’s city skyline and Waitematā Harbour. Travelers report that the vantage point is “mesmerizing,” offering a perfect photo opportunity and a sense of the city’s layout. The 104-minute stop allows plenty of time for snapping pictures and absorbing the scenery.

Achilles Point: Rugged Cliffs and Marine Stories

Next, the group heads to Achilles Point, where the rugged coastline and Hauraki Gulf views evoke a sense of wild beauty. The 46-minute visit is short but impactful, with reviewers highlighting the whispering cliffs and myth-infused surroundings. It’s a spot that adds a bit of drama and history to the journey.

Maungakiekie (One Tree Hill): Cultural Heart and Volcanic Origins

A highlight for many, Maungakiekie is steeped in Māori heritage and geological significance. The 50-minute stop gives visitors a chance to learn about its volcanic origins and its importance to local Māori tribes. Travelers appreciate the peaceful atmosphere and the chance to connect with New Zealand’s indigenous roots. Some reviews mention that guides are knowledgeable about the site’s cultural stories, adding depth to the visit.

Viaduct Harbour: Modernity Meets Maritime Tradition

The final stop is at Auckland’s Vibrant Waterfront, where the buzzing cafes, luxury yachts, and lively atmosphere showcase Auckland’s maritime identity. The 40-minute visit offers a relaxing stroll, perfect for soaking in the city’s modern flair. Many reviewers mention that the area feels like the heartbeat of Auckland, blending contemporary urban life with maritime traditions.
